Microsoft Emissions Surge 25% as AI Growth Tests 2030 Carbon Pledge

The tech giant's emissions have jumped 25 per cent in a single year, with mass timber data centres and forest-linked carbon removals now carrying more weight than ever in a carbon-negative pledge its executives insist is still alive.

Microsoft’s push to become carbon negative by 2030 is drifting further from reach, with the tech giant’s total emissions surging 25 per cent in a single year to sit nearly 58 per cent above its 2020 baseline. The blowout, driven by the breakneck expansion of AI data centres, has the company leaning harder than ever on mass timber construction and forest-linked carbon removal to claw back its emissions.

Published on Thursday, Microsoft’s 2026 Environmental Sustainability Report puts the company’s emissions for the 12 months to June 2025 at 20.3 million tonnes of carbon dioxide equivalent across its operations and supply chain, up from 16.2 million tonnes a year earlier. Electricity consumption climbed 24 per cent over the same period as the company expanded the computing capacity behind Azure, Copilot and its OpenAI partnership.

Part of the increase is self-inflicted, with Microsoft choosing to stop buying unbundled renewable energy certificates, an accounting instrument that trimmed its reported emissions without adding new clean electricity to the grid. In their place, the company will back long-term agreements now covering up to 40 gigawatts across 26 countries, with 19 gigawatts already operational.

In the report’s foreword, Microsoft Vice Chair and President Brad Smith and Chief Sustainability Officer Melanie Nakagawa conceded that the collision between AI growth and the company’s 2020-era climate pledges is forcing hard choices: “This tension is real,” the pair wrote, adding that it is pushing the company to ask where it needs to move faster, invest differently or rethink its approach altogether.

Mass timber is Microsoft’s carbon answer…

Crucially for the forest products sector, the report’s answer is not to retreat from AI but to bundle carbon-free electricity, carbon removal, sustainable fuels and lower-carbon construction materials, including mass timber, into a single decarbonisation portfolio.

No tech giant is further down that road than Microsoft, which in November 2024 opened the world’s first data centres built from cross-laminated timber in Northern Virginia, a Gensler-designed hybrid system the company estimates cuts embodied carbon by 35 per cent compared with steel and 65 per cent compared with precast concrete. “A lot of our suppliers are on the same journey as we are,” Jim Hanna, sustainability lead for Microsoft’s data centre engineering team, said at the time.

That model has since been adopted by Amazon and Meta, with big tech now accounting for up to 10 per cent of all mass timber sold in the United States. “Mass timber is the smartest structural choice available right now for data centre construction,” Washington-based building materials expert David Stallcop said ahead of this year’s International Mass Timber Conference in Portland, Oregon.

Redmond is also one of the world’s biggest buyers of wood-linked carbon removal, signing a deal in April last year to purchase more than 3.685 million tonnes of carbon dioxide removal credits over 12 years from CO280, a start-up capturing biogenic emissions from US pulp and paper mills for permanent geological storage. “The trees do the heavy lifting; they absorb the CO2,” CO280 chief executive Jonathan Rhone said of the agreement.

The new report shows why those bets matter, with Scope 3 emissions, covering construction, purchased hardware and suppliers, remaining the largest slice of Microsoft’s total. Electricity-linked Scope 2 emissions, meanwhile, ballooned from nearly 2 per cent to 13 per cent in the space of a single year.

Chief executive Satya Nadella claims the buildings themselves are changing too, with a new closed-loop cooling design allowing AI data centres to use as much water annually as a restaurant. Elsewhere, the company replenished 14.2 million cubic metres of water, exceeding its global withdrawals for the first time, and recycled or reused 92 per cent of its retired cloud hardware.

Further wins came in waste and land, with 90.5 per cent of construction and demolition material diverted from disposal and 16,266 acres legally protected, 36 per cent more than the company’s operations occupy.

Progress on paper has not quieted critics on the ground, with residents protesting a planned facility near Granger, Indiana, and neighbours of the US$7.3 billion Fairwater AI complex in Wisconsin suing over noise, dust and light pollution. It comes as Microsoft’s global estate passes 300 data centres across 34 countries, twelve months after the company’s previous report showed data centre growth threatening its net-zero goals. Smith and Nakagawa insist the 2030 target remains feasible, with every environmental lever, from timber to carbon capture, run as one portfolio, but on numbers published, Microsoft has 4 years to eliminate 20.3 million tonnes of emissions, then go beyond zero.
